Transaction 92a521b5d26187f4786b9eaae5cd64f0a01303b6b11fc5ba8843408372960d38
2 Input
1 Outputs
- 92a521b5d26187f4786b9eaae5cd64f0a01303b6b11fc5ba8843408372960d38:0
value 7992548
address 3BsZHzE9b1TxJE3BpPr1krsia3C5vLzXAg